Really love this place! My family is moving to Asia soon, but I wish we could keep coming here regularly to support them! Because, (especially for a strip mall sushi place), they are wonderful. Our first time here the kids were melting down and the waitress was so patient and kind. 2nd time I came alone, right when they opened, and they were mopping with a strong smelling cleaner which was bothering my throat...They propped open the front door for me to ensure my comfort! That meant a lot to me because I really wanted sashimi for breakfast & I couldn't have stayed otherwise! But let's talk about the food. Do yourself a favor and get the Sashimi Appetizer...the presentation is so special with little purple (fake) flowers, and the nice cuts of fish come on tiny beds of shredded daikon with shizo leaves...both of which I adore. The lunch special is a great deal, even though the rolls aren't large. Their ginger doesn't have pink dye in it which I always appreciate. Their homemade salad dressing it quite literally the best I've ever had, loaded with a mild ginger. We all-around love this place and I will miss being able to walk over! I hope they continue to thrive as a business.

I had a great visit at this local business! I met up a friend for girl's night and we split the edamame, agedashi tofu, Vegetable Roll and Larry's Roll. We are outside which was quiet and great for beautiful food photos. The server was very attentive and patient while we asked to make sure our meals would be vegan. She let us know that their tempura batter does not have egg. Next time I will try their sweet potato roll! The appetizers were great. We got a generous portion of edamame. It was lightly salted and filling. The agedashi tofu is always one of my favorite appetizers. I liked that theirs had lots of crispy onion bits and seaweed on top. The dipping sauce was delicious and I would order this again! I was so impressed that this business had two vegetable rolls on their menu! The main vegetable roll was not the typical avocado, cucumber, and carrot roll. Instead it actually had interesting vegetables like pickled radish which made this meal feel elevated instead of just a step up from the grocery store. The Larry's Roll was the star of the meal for me. I love that it had both seaweed salad and mango in it! It was hearty which is rare to find for vegan sushi. These two rolls are more than enough reason to have this place bookmarked as a place to patron as a vegan. I do wish that the plate did not have that decoration on the side with the Mayo based sauce. Luckily nothing contaminated my rolls, and I will ask for that to be left off the plate when I come back for another visit. Our meal with two appetizers and two rolls was $28. Not a bad girl's night price at all! We thought about ordering the fried banana for dessert without whipped cream but we will just have to wait to try that for next time!

TL;DR the dinner/regular prices are too high and the size of their special rolls are WAY too small! Their sushi itself is fresh and tastes very good, and you get the best deal by doing their weekday/Saturday lunch specials and using the coupons they occasionally mail out. I will still return for that! My parents and I have been frequenting Moko Sushi since it opened because of its convenient location and good sushi roll lunch specials. However, I've cut back a star. While their sushi rolls taste pretty good, the size of the special rolls are always SO SMALL for their price of ~$15. Today, we ordered the 2 and 3 roll lunch special and 1 special roll (American dream). I have no problem with the normal sushi roll size, but the special roll literally looked like it was only 4 pieces rather than 8 when I saw it. Turned out the roll that looked a single roll was really 2 small rolls stuck together. Their special roll pieces are not any bigger than their normal sushi rolls -- in fact, they might be SMALLER! In my opinion, the size of their special roll is literally 1/2 the size of other popular sushi stops in MoCo, like Yuraku and Love Sushi, which are priced the same or even less.
